[Intel-gfx] [PATCH] drm/i915: Fix hibernation with ACPI S0 target state

> > during hibernation/suspend the power domain functionality got disabled,
> > after which resume could leave it incorrectly disabled if the ACPI
> > target state was S0 during suspend and i915 was not loaded by the loader
> > kernel.
> > 
> > This was caused by not considering if we resumed from hibernation as the
> > condition for power domains reiniting.
> > 
> > Fix this by simply tracking if we suspended power domains during system
> > suspend and reinit power domains accordingly during resume. This will
> > result in reiniting power domains always when resuming from hibernation,
> > regardless of the platform and whether or not i915 is loaded by the
> > loader kernel.
> > 
> > The reason we didn't catch this earlier is that the enabled/disabled
> > state of power domains during PMSG_FREEZE/PMSG_QUIESCE is platform
> > and kernel config dependent: on my SKL the target state is S4
> > during PMSG_FREEZE and (with the driver loaded in the loader kernel)
> > S0 during PMSG_QUIESCE. On the reporter's machine it's S0 during
> > PMSG_FREEZE but (contrary to this) power domains are not initialized
> > during PMSG_QUIESCE since i915 is not loaded in the loader kernel, or
> > it's loaded but without the DMC firmware being available.

> On thing I can't quite tell is what happens with switcheroo. Maybe it's
> not even relevant for platforms with DC6 in which case I suppose it
> should work correctly.

Yep I haven't noticed that issue. On GEN9+ big core machines hibernating from a
switcheroo off state looks broken for a similar reason: Switcheroo-off on those
machines corresponds to suspending to idle and so DC6, but after resuming from
hibernation power domains and so DC states will be disabled.

The following is one way to fix that preventing s2idle for switcheroo. Since
it's a separate existing issue I could send a proper patch as a follow-up.
